这里是文章模块栏目内容页
mysql集群日志(mysql日志binlog)

导读:MySQL集群日志是数据库中非常重要的一部分,它记录了数据库的所有操作和事件。本文将从以下几个方面进行介绍:1.什么是MySQL集群日志;2. MySQL集群日志的作用;3. MySQL集群日志的类型;4. MySQL集群日志的配置;5. MySQL集群日志的管理。

1. 什么是MySQL集群日志

MySQL集群日志是指在MySQL集群中记录所有数据库操作和事件的文件。它是MySQL集群的一个重要组成部分,可以帮助管理员快速定位问题,并提供故障恢复和数据备份等功能。

2. MySQL集群日志的作用

MySQL集群日志有多种作用,主要包括以下几个方面:

(1)故障恢复:当数据库出现故障时,管理员可以通过查看日志文件来确定具体的故障原因,并进行相应的修复。

(2)性能优化:通过对日志文件的分析,管理员可以了解数据库的使用情况,进而进行性能优化。

(3)数据备份:通过定期备份日志文件,管理员可以保证数据的安全性。

(4)审计跟踪:日志文件可以记录所有的数据库操作和事件,可以为审计提供依据。

3. MySQL集群日志的类型

MySQL集群日志主要包括以下几种类型:

(1)错误日志:记录MySQL集群中的错误信息。

(2)二进制日志:记录所有修改数据库的操作,包括增删改查等操作。

(3)慢查询日志:记录执行时间超过指定阈值的SQL语句。

(4)查询日志:记录所有的SQL语句。

4. MySQL集群日志的配置

MySQL集群日志的配置需要在my.cnf文件中进行设置。具体的配置参数包括:

(1)log_error:指定错误日志文件的路径和文件名。

(2)log_bin:指定二进制日志文件的路径和文件名。

(3)slow_query_log:指定慢查询日志文件的路径和文件名。

(4)general_log:指定查询日志文件的路径和文件名。

5. MySQL集群日志的管理

MySQL集群日志的管理包括以下几个方面:

(1)定期备份日志文件。

(2)定期清理日志文件,避免占用过多磁盘空间。

(3)定期分析日志文件,发现问题并进行相应的优化和修复。

总结:MySQL集群日志是MySQL集群中非常重要的一部分,可以帮助管理员进行故障恢复、性能优化、数据备份和审计跟踪等工作。管理员需要了解MySQL集群日志的类型和配置方法,并对日志文件进行定期备份、清理和分析。